Neuropeptides and Peptide Hormones in Anopheles gambiae
Michael A. Riehle,1*Stephen F. Garczynski,2*Joe W. Crim,2Catherine A. Hill,3Mark R. Brown1
The African malaria mosquito, Anopheles gambiae,
is specialized for rapid completion of development and reproduction. A
vertebrateblood meal is required for egg production, and multiple
feedingssubsequently allow transmission of malaria parasites,
Plasmodiumspp. Regulatory peptides from 35 genes
annotated from the A. gambiaegenome likely coordinate these
and other physiological processes.Plasmodium parasites may
affect actions of newly identified insulin-likepeptides, which
coordinate growth and reproduction of its vector,A. gambiae, as in Drosophila melanogaster,
Caenorhabditis elegans,and mammals. This genomic
information provides a basis to expandunderstanding of hematophagy and
pathogen transmission in thismosquito.
